Alicia Schuelke
Trainer

Alicia started in the health and wellness field when she was 18 years old as a Personal Training Intern at Gold’s Gym. Since then she has graduated from the University of Wisconsin Eau Claire with a degree in Kinesiology-Movement Studies and a minor in Business Management. For the past 11 years she has worked as a NASM Certified Personal Trainer for four major corporate franchise gyms at a managerial level. In September of 2015 she left the corporate gym world and started her own company, Signature Fitness, in an effort to provide a more customized training experience to her clientele. Her specializations are in Sports Performance Training, Weight Loss, Fitness Competition Prep and Active Isolated Stretching. She’s currently the Head Boys Track and Field Coach and Strength and Conditioning Summer Program Coach at Cooper High School in New Hope, MN.
